Stability of NiCrAlY coating/titanium alloy system under pure thermal exposure

摘    要:In this paper,NiCrAlY coating was deposited on TC4 titanium alloy using arc ion plating,and the stability of NiCrAlY coating/TC4 substrate system under pure thermal exposure was analyzed in a wide temperature range.During the thermal exposure,β→γ′→γphase transformation takes place in the NiCrAlY coating.The NiCrAlY coating phases totally decompose above the allotropic transformation temperature of TC4.The allotropic transformation ofα-Ti to β-Ti of the substrate significantly influences the stability of NiCrAlY coating/TC4 substrate system.NiCrAlY coating elements are mainly consumed by interfacial reactions below the allotropic transformation temperature of TC4.Above the allotropic transformation temperature of TC4,NiCrAlY coating elements are mainly consumed by element dissolution in β-Ti.The NiCrAlY coating totally degrades for the dissolution of coating elements in the substrate to form thickβ-Ti stabilized layer.
